Perfectionism!
What is "perfect" when it comes to our knitting and crafting projects varies from maker to maker. For example, some sock knitters must knit perfectly matching socks! Others don't mind if the striping varies or if the toes are knit in different colors. Does your need for perfection hold you back from trying new things? Does it ever keep you from finishing projects? Gayle shares the story of her Ashes shawl.
